The new LG 45GX990A is a 45-inch gaming monitor that can smoothly transition from completely flat to a 900R curvature monitor in seconds.
LG introduced two new members of its UltraGear line of gaming monitors called the new 45GX990A and the 45GX950A 45-inch, 21:9 OLED gaming monitors with a 5,120 x 2,160 resolution. With the generous screen real estate, these monitors should offer a better experience not only for gaming but for various applications. Both products feature LG's second-generation dual-mode, allowing users to customize aspect ratio and picture sizes with one-touch switching between preset screen resolution and refresh rate combinations.
Both monitors feature the dual mode above with up to 8 customizable configurations. The two monitors also feature DisplayPort 2.1, HDMI 2.1 and USB-C with 90W power delivery. It supports variable refresh rates and is compatible with NVIDIA G-Sync and AMD FreeSync Premium Pro.
The 45GX950A features a 45-inch panel with a fixed 800R curve while the 45GX90A has a 45-inch bendable OLED panel with a fast 0.03ms GTG response time. It can transition from flat to 900R within seconds.
LG claims that both monitors feature high brightness while being easy on the eyes. It is certified for low blue light emissions and the panels feature LG's Anti-Glare and Low reflection coatings.
